Ambient Corp. has released the latest version of its network management system, AmbientNMS, a purpose-built suite of integrated software applications for real time fault, performance analysis, and reporting of characteristics of the medium- and low-voltage grid infrastructure.
This latest version of AmbientNMS features new tools for interpreting, arranging and sharing data, allowing the utility to create preselected users or groups, with the ability to create an experience custom-tailored to that individual's role, tasks and priorities:
Auto-discover devices without user input / intervention
Enhanced customizable lists and maps may be viewed at various levels such as state, city and street level down to a single device's information
Maps may be organized geographically or with electrical substation and circuit topology imposed on them
Retrieve and present real time data such as energy use
Create reoccurring reports from regularly collected data
Control and share desired data-based metrics and users
Configurable events and alarms based on user-defined thresholds to discern the urgent and important information amid the vast quantity of available data
Enriched charting and export functions for subsequent further analysis
Forward events such as outage notifications to (user-defined) third-party applications.
The primary function of the AmbientNMS is to provide an extensible system for managing the communications network between grid devices and the existing back-office systems. The NMS can monitor and manage tasks, run discovery and status checks, query devices, and store and relay information and instructions between the NMS and the Ambient Smart Grid Nodes. It distributes software upgrades to the nodes and manages other downstream devices conforming to existing standards.
In addition, the Ambient Smart Grid Platform facilitates multiple applications in parallel, including, but not limited to, multi-service smart metering, outage detection and restoration management, power quality monitoring, and distribution automation (for legacy and new) infrastructure assets. The AmbientNMS automates the collection and reporting of data from hosted applications; both Ambient's own and third parties' and can be integrated into other utility operational systems.
